President Donald Trump has refused to sign the most comprehensive housing legislation in decades, withholding his signature until Congress passes an elections bill with little prospect of advancing. CBS News
The president abruptly canceled a signing ceremony at the Capitol on Wednesday, posting on social media that he would not act until lawmakers take up the SAVE America Act. The desk and presidential seal had already been set up in Statuary Hall. CBS News
The 21st Century ROAD to Housing Act passed both chambers with veto-proof majorities and restricts institutional investors from buying certain single-family homes. It becomes law within ten days regardless of whether Mr. Trump signs. The Hill + 2
He called the measure “of minor importance.” Republicans had planned to campaign on it this autumn. PBS
